Aside from time (a non-trivial consideration) is there any reason not to put them on both wikiHow and the LW wiki?

Comment author: TheOtherDave 11 February 2011 02:22:34PM 4 points [-]

A hard-earned lesson from my days as a technical writer: "a man with two watches never knows the time." That is, any piece of information maintained in two places will sooner or later progress inconsistently.

Putting it in one place and a pointer to it in the other place might be better.
